Kinds Of Energy-Efficient Glass



Different advanced kinds of energy-efficient glass offer distinct homes that provide to different needs and preferences in boosting the sustainability and efficiency of buildings. Triple-pane glass, consisting of 3 layers of glass with shielding gas between them, offers improved thermal insulation, making it very energy-efficient. In addition, self-cleaning glass with a special finishing that damages down and loosens up dust when exposed to sunlight can decrease upkeep demands and maintain windows looking tidy.

Setup and Upkeep Tips

To ensure optimal performance and durability of your energy-efficient windows, it is crucial to adhere to recommended installation and maintenance practices. It is recommended to hire expert installers who have experience working with energy-efficient windows.


Routine upkeep is vital to maintaining the effectiveness of your energy-efficient home windows. Check the windows periodically for any indicators of sealer, wear, or damage degeneration. Clean the frames, tracks, and glass routinely using light soap and water to eliminate dirt and crud that can affect performance. Examine the weather-stripping and seals for any splits or gaps and change them if needed to preserve the windows' power effectiveness.


Furthermore, oil moving components such as locks and hinges to make certain smooth operation. By adhering to these installation and upkeep tips, you can improve the energy effectiveness of your home and lengthen the lifespan of your energy-efficient home windows.




Cost-Benefit Analysis of Upgrading

Conducting an extensive cost-benefit evaluation of updating to energy-efficient home windows is important for figuring out why not look here the economic stability and long-term savings potential of the investment. While energy-efficient windows may have a higher in advance expense contrasted to typical home windows, the lasting advantages usually surpass the first financial investment. When evaluating the cost-benefit of updating, take into consideration factors such as energy savings, increased property worth, possible tax obligation credit ratings or incentives, and upkeep prices gradually.


Energy-efficient home windows are created to reduce heat transfer, reducing the need for home heating and cooling down systems to burn the midnight oil. This can lead to significant financial savings on power expenses, particularly in areas with severe temperatures. Additionally, energy-efficient home windows can improve the general worth of your home, making it a lot more attractive to possible customers if you decide to sell in the future.


When calculating the cost-benefit evaluation, consider the prospective savings on energy costs, any type of available motivations or refunds, and the lifespan of the home windows. While the initial price may be greater, the long-lasting savings and advantages of energy-efficient windows make them a wise investment for home owners seeking to improve their building's energy performance and value.
